Monthly Cost of Living

A single person spends $2,998 per month in Fresno, CA vs $3,507 in Singapore, rent included.

A couple spends around $4,232 per month in Fresno, CA vs $5,136 in Singapore, rent included.

A family of three spends $5,465 per month in Fresno, CA vs $6,764 in Singapore, rent included.

Fresno, CA is about 15% cheaper than Singapore, driven mainly by Eating Out.

Both Fresno, CA and Singapore sit above the global median – Fresno, CA by 124%, Singapore by 163%.

Cost Breakdown

A central one-bedroom costs $1,567 in Fresno, CA versus $3,209 in Singapore. Rent is usually the largest line item in a monthly budget, so the gap here sets the tone for the overall comparison.

Salaries run about 6% higher in Singapore, which partly offsets the higher cost of living there. Purchasing power depends on which expenses matter most to you.

A mid-range dinner for two costs $69.0 in Fresno, CA versus $78.0 in Singapore. Monthly groceries follow the same trend: $380 vs $450 – making Fresno, CA the more affordable choice for daily food spending.
